Ordinals
beta
Sat 707445033718116
decimal
141489.33718116
degree
0°141489′369″33718116‴
percentile
33.687858785538374%
name
ivlkybatbfx
cycle
0
epoch
0
period
70
block
141489
offset
33718116
timestamp
2011-08-18 13:46:38 UTC
rarity
common
prev
next